About
Dr. Hao Gao is a leading researcher in robotics and networked systems, with a primary focus on the coordinated control of robot swarms for infrastructure monitoring. His most significant contribution lies in developing a hybrid control approach that enables robot swarms to efficiently detect critical nodes within heterogeneous sensor networks (HSNs). This work directly addresses the longstanding challenges of prohibitive search costs and inaccurate detection that have plagued current methods. By integrating decentralized decision-making with centralized coordination, Gao’s framework dramatically improves both the speed and reliability of identifying malfunctioning or vulnerable nodes, offering a scalable solution for maintaining large-scale, complex networks. His 2025 paper on this topic has already garnered early citations, signaling its growing influence in the field. Gao’s research bridges theoretical control theory with practical swarm robotics, providing a foundation for future work in autonomous infrastructure maintenance, environmental monitoring, and disaster response. His innovative approach promises to reduce operational costs and enhance the resilience of critical networked systems, marking him as a rising authority in intelligent robotic systems.
